Output 11d70e3c3f77940e42f2f37494e44e83bd32ea4b0a814b15d8ab68d794d85c29:5

value
58790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e51bb49ebeb379e9e934bf6dbbc5aa94e352c73 OP_EQUAL
address
3QsjU5Zwp1Eqv3VFongm8qDU1L8KizNfs3
transaction
11d70e3c3f77940e42f2f37494e44e83bd32ea4b0a814b15d8ab68d794d85c29
confirmations
492382
spent
true